Transaction 0526c3907218f89fdba2de7f0c2dfbf0295e8f405ab51a156932df30abb4db99

1 Input
2 Outputs
  • 0526c3907218f89fdba2de7f0c2dfbf0295e8f405ab51a156932df30abb4db99:0
  • value  1398016
    address  2NAC7D2j1zzPmpE1sTrbuYxi14wGEBdfJbu
  • 0526c3907218f89fdba2de7f0c2dfbf0295e8f405ab51a156932df30abb4db99:1
  • value  100000
    address  msS2gUWmhtx6HEgyESCXVovQtMaoUHMdLP